How to Plan a Successful Remodel Timeline

Completing a remodel before the holidays requires careful planning and coordination. Here’s how to stay on schedule and stress-free:

Step 1: Define Your Priorities
Start by identifying which spaces will make the biggest impact. Is it your outdated kitchen, your cramped guest bathroom, or an unfinished basement? Defining your priorities helps set clear goals for your remodel.

Step 2: Schedule a Design Consultation Early
Meeting with your remodeling team in late summer or early fall ensures enough time for planning, permitting, and ordering materials. Design-build firms like Hammer streamline this process by managing every phase—from concept to completion—under one roof.

Step 3: Establish a Realistic Timeline
Each project type has its own schedule. For example, kitchens often take 8–12 weeks, while additions or full-home renovations require more time. Hammer’s team develops detailed project calendars so homeowners can confidently plan around their expected completion date.

Step 4: Communicate Regularly with Your Team
Consistent updates help keep projects on track. Our design-build process includes transparent communication at every stage, ensuring you know exactly what’s happening and when.

Step 5: Prepare for the Unexpected
Even with careful planning, remodels can uncover surprises—like outdated wiring or structural adjustments. Building in flexibility ensures that your project stays stress-free and on course for the holidays.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Remodeling Before the Holidays

Starting a project close to the holidays requires strategy. Avoid these frequent pitfalls:

1. Waiting Too Long to Start
Many homeowners underestimate how long design, permitting, and construction can take. Start your remodel months in advance to avoid seasonal scheduling backlogs.

2. Overlooking Design Consistency
When updating individual spaces, ensure design elements like finishes, colors, and materials remain cohesive across rooms. A design-build team helps unify your project vision.

3. Ignoring Function for Aesthetics
A stunning remodel means little if it doesn’t serve your needs. Prioritize workflow, storage, and comfort alongside visual appeal.

4. DIY During a Time Crunch
Attempting to handle a remodel yourself right before the holidays often leads to delays and frustration. Partnering with professionals ensures your project stays on schedule and up to standard.


Frequently Asked Questions

How far in advance should I start my holiday remodel?
Ideally, you should begin the design process at least three to four months before your target completion date to allow for planning, permits, and any unexpected delays.

Which rooms add the most value before the holidays?
Kitchen and bathroom remodels typically offer the highest impact and ROI, followed by functional additions like guest rooms or finished basements.

Can a remodel really be completed before the holidays?
Yes—with a design-build team managing your project, timelines are streamlined. Starting early ensures every detail is completed before guests arrive.

Do I need permits for small projects?
Even minor remodels often require permits, especially if plumbing or structural changes are involved. Hammer handles all permitting to keep your project compliant.
